The Rise of High-Quality Fakes: A Double-Edged Sword in the Modern Market
In the 21st century, the expansion of premium fakes has actually ended up being a substantial phenomenon, affecting industries ranging from luxury goods to electronic devices and even pharmaceuticals. These counterfeit items are no longer easily distinguishable from the real short articles, presenting difficulties for customers, brands, and regulative bodies. This short article looks into the world of premium fakes, exploring their effect, the technology behind them, and the procedures being required to fight this issue.

The Evolution of Counterfeiting
Counterfeiting has actually existed for centuries, however the development of sophisticated innovation has changed the landscape. Top quality fakes, or advanced counterfeits, are now made utilizing methods that simulate the genuine items almost completely. This has actually led to a surge in customer demand for these fakes, driven by elements such as cost, status, and the desire for high-end without the premium price.

Effect on the Market
Financial Consequences

Loss of Revenue: Brands suffer substantial financial losses due to the sale of counterfeit products. According to the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D), the global trade in counterfeit items is estimated to be worth over $500 billion annually.
Employment: The counterfeit market utilizes a vast variety of people, a lot of whom work in substandard conditions, frequently in developing nations. This can result in labor exploitation and a lack of employee rights.
Development: Counterfeiting stifles development by taking the fruits of real R&D efforts. Companies invest heavily in establishing brand-new products, and the proliferation of fakes can weaken their motivation to continue innovating.
Customer Safety

Health Risks: Counterfeit pharmaceuticals and cosmetics can position major health dangers to consumers. These items frequently do not have the quality assurance and security standards of authentic items, resulting in potential unfavorable impacts.
Technical Failures: In the electronics and automotive industries, high-quality fakes can cause technical breakdowns and security threats. For instance, counterfeit batteries have been known to explode, triggering injuries.
Brand name Reputation

Trust Erosion: Consumers who unwittingly buy counterfeit products may experience bad efficiency or even damage, leading to a loss of rely on the brand name. This can have long-lasting consequences for brand loyalty and market track record.
Innovation Behind High-Quality Fakes
Advanced Manufacturing Techniques

3D Printing: This innovation has actually made it simpler to produce exact reproductions of products, from complex precious jewelry to intricate electronic parts.
High-Resolution Printing: Counterfeiters utilize high-resolution printers to reproduce logos, labels, and packaging, making it difficult for consumers to recognize fakes.
Supply Chain Infiltration

Component Sourcing: Sophisticated counterfeiters typically source authentic elements to produce their fakes, making it much more difficult to spot them.
Logistical Sophistication: The counterfeit industry has actually established intricate supply chains, typically involving numerous countries, to evade detection and ensure a constant supply of fake items.
Digital Manipulation

Online Marketplaces: The internet has actually offered a vast platform for the sale of high-quality fakes. Online markets, while hassle-free, can be breeding grounds for counterfeit products.
Social Media Influencers: Some counterfeiters utilize social networks influencers to promote their fake items, leveraging the trust these people have developed with their fans.
Combating High-Quality Fakes
Legislation and Regulation

International Cooperation: Collaboration in between countries is essential for combating the global nature of counterfeiting. Interpol and other worldwide bodies work together to take apart counterfeit networks.
Brand Strategies

Identification Numbers and Tags: Many brand names are including special serial numbers or tags that customers can verify to guarantee the credibility of their purchases.
Blockchain Technology: Blockchain can offer a transparent and secure way to track the origin and journey of items, making it harder for counterfeiters to penetrate the supply chain.

Verification Tools: Apps and online tools are readily available to help consumers confirm the authenticity of items. These tools frequently use AI and machine learning to compare items with real articles.
Frequently Asked Questions About High-Quality Fakes
What are premium fakes?

Premium fakes, or advanced counterfeits, are replica products that are produced to carefully look like real products. They are often equivalent from the real thing, even to knowledgeable consumers.
How can I inform if an item is a top quality fake?

Search for inconsistencies in the packaging, such as misspelled words or poor-quality labels. Examine the product's identification number or tag using the brand's confirmation tool. If the price appears too good to be true, it probably is.


Are high-quality fakes unlawful?

Yes, the production and sale of counterfeit items are prohibited in the majority of nations. These activities are often connected with the mob and can lead to severe legal charges.
What are the dangers of buying high-quality fakes?

The dangers include health risks (especially with pharmaceuticals and cosmetics), technical malfunctions (in electronics and automobile products), and financial losses. Furthermore, supporting the counterfeit market can add to labor exploitation and undermine real services.
How can brand names secure themselves from high-quality fakes?

Brands can implement identification numbers, tags, and blockchain technology to track and confirm their items. They can likewise buy consumer education and work with regulatory bodies to implement anti-counterfeiting laws.
Conclusion
The increase of premium fakes is an intricate issue with far-reaching implications. While the counterfeit industry prospers on customer demand for budget-friendly high-end, the risks connected with these items are considerable. Federal governments, brands, and consumers should work together to combat this problem, utilizing a combination of legislation, innovation, and education. By remaining notified and watchful, customers can safeguard themselves from the risks of high-quality fakes, and brands can protect their credibilities and monetary wellness.
